import gradio as gr
from PIL import Image
import pillow_heif
import io
def heic_to_png(heic_file, compression, lossless):
# Read HEIC image
heif_file = pillow_heif.read_heif(heic_file.name)
image = Image.frombytes(
heif_file.mode, heif_file.size, heif_file.data, "raw"
)
# Prepare output buffer
png_bytes = io.BytesIO()
if lossless:
# Save with default PNG settings (lossless)
image.save(png_bytes, format="PNG", optimize=True)
else:
# PNG compression: 0 (no compression, largest file) to 9 (max compression, smallest file)
# Map slider 0-100 to PNG compress_level 0-9
compress_level = int(9 - (compression / 100) * 9)
image.save(
png_bytes,
format="PNG",
compress_level=compress_level,
optimize=True
)
png_bytes.seek(0)
return png_bytes
with gr.Blocks() as demo:
gr.Markdown("## HEIC to PNG Converter")
gr.Markdown(
"Upload a HEIC image, adjust compression, or enable 'Professional Lossless' for maximum PNG quality."
)
with gr.Row():
heic_input = gr.File(label="Upload HEIC Image", file_types=[".heic"])
png_output = gr.File(label="Converted PNG", file_types=[".png"])
compression = gr.Slider(
minimum=0,
maximum=100,
value=90,
step=1,
label="Compression Amount (0=Max compression, 100=Least compression)",
info="Set to 100 for highest quality (least compression)."
)
lossless = gr.Checkbox(
label="Professional Lossless (Ignore compression slider)",
value=False
)
convert_btn = gr.Button("Convert")
convert_btn.click(
fn=heic_to_png,
inputs=[heic_input, compression, lossless],
outputs=png_output
)
demo.launch()
